在Java中,IoC / DI是一种非常常见的实践,广泛应用于web应用程序、几乎所有可用的框架和Java EE中。另一方面,也有很多大型的Python web应用程序,但除了Zope(我听说它的编码

类方法和实例方法的区别是什么?实例方法是访问器(getter和setter),而类方法几乎是其他所有东西吗?

我想要的不是Redis和MongoDB之间的比较。我知道它们是不同的;性能和API是完全不同的。Redis非常快,但是API非常“原子化”。MongoDB会消耗更多的资源,但是API非常非常容易使用,

这个问题不是关于什么时候使用GET或POST;这是关于哪一个是建议处理注销web应用程序。我已经找到了大量关于GET和POST之间一般意义上的区别的信息,但是我没有找到针对这个特定场景的明确答案。作为

随着像jQuery这样的JavaScript框架使客户端web应用程序更丰富,功能更强大,我开始注意到一个问题…你到底是怎么组织起来的?把所有的处理程序放在一个地方,并为所有事件编写函数?创建函数/类

我刚刚掌握了MVC框架,我经常想知道在模型中应该有多少代码。我倾向于有一个数据访问类,它有这样的方法:我的模型往往是映射到数据库表的实体类。模型对象是否应该像上面的代码一样具有所有的数据库映射属性,或

我想知道是否有人能给我一个概述,为什么我要使用它们,在这个过程中我能获得什么好处。

我知道@符号可以用在字符串文字之前,以改变编译器如何解析字符串。但是,当变量名的前缀是@符号时,这意味着什么呢?

在SQLAlchemy中flush()和commit()之间有什么区别?我读了这些文件,但还是不明白——他们似乎假设了一个我没有的预先理解。我对它们对内存使用的影响特别感兴趣。我正在从一系列文件(总共

我需要一些澄清。我一直在阅读关于REST和构建基于REST的应用程序的书籍。根据维基百科,REST本身被定义为具象状态传输。因此,我不理解所有这些无国籍的官样文章,每个人都在不停地吐出来。从维基百科: